About the position

The Western Sugar Cooperative is seeking dedicated individuals to join our team for the Campaign Season at our Fort Morgan facility. This is a seasonal, full-time position offering a starting pay of $19.00 per hour, with the potential for overtime. We are committed to training the right candidates, so no prior experience is necessary. The role requires a willingness to work rotating 8-hour shifts while being on your feet for the duration of the shift. Candidates must also be able to pass pre-screen and random drug testing as part of our commitment to maintaining a drug-free workplace. As a member of our team, you will be expected to demonstrate solid safety behaviors and take on the role of a safety leader. Regular attendance is crucial, and you will be trained as a Process Helper, which involves learning multiple positions within the factory. Effective communication with the Shift Supervisor and fellow team members is essential, as is the ability to multitask and stay organized. You will also need to possess good verbal and written communication skills, as well as the ability to read and understand technical manuals related to sugar factory processes. This position offers opportunities for advancement to different roles with increased pay, and there is potential for year-round employment following the campaign season. We are looking for motivated individuals who are willing to maintain a clean and safe production area and who are eager to learn about the sugar manufacturing process.
